Bears are really hard to judge except by true professional guides who have been doing it for many years. And not knowing the surroundings to compare him against (can't really tell if its a boar or not from these pics) like tree size etc. its even more difficult. Most people over estimate bear weight because of their really fluffy fur. But from the bear I've taken and looking at the size of his ears in relation to his head I'd estimate him to be about 200 lb. No more than 250 live weight.

I estimate bear size by the front pad on there paw 6 inch across is big 400-500lb 3 inch is small one. Put a bucket of sand near the camera and measure the front pad width.
